Main duties of the job

Has 24‑hour accountability for patient safety and patient experience on ward/department, including line‑management of staff.

Must deliver high‑quality midwifery care by ensuring appropriate systems and processes are in place to provide continuity of safe and effective care at all times.

Act as champion for professional accountability and standards, ensuring professional practices are in‑line with requirements of Nursing and Midwifery Council (NMC), and Trust Policy.

Ensure environmental standards and cleanliness of ward/department/community team are maintained in‑line with Trust and National standards.

Effectively manage ward/department/sector midwifery resource, ensuring staff rotas are able to deliver safe and effective patient care.

Support and contribute to development of patient care and midwifery practice within Directorate. Contribute to Trust‑wide projects as required.

Ensure staff are supported in performing to full potential. Ensure junior staff have appropriate support and supervision and are appropriately assessed.

To comply with Trust's vision, values and behavioural compact.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
